This years Billabong Pro Tahiti event will mark the 10 year anniversary of Kelly Slater’s first win at Teahupoo in 2000.

Due to the smaller conditions on the final day of the contest back then, Kelly rode a 6’1 x 18 1/4 x 2″ MK2K (K-Board). The nose is much narrower and has much more of a pronounced flip in it which was characteristic of the time.

Here are a few photos of the board he rode in the finals. The board hangs in the Channel Islands Surfboards Flagship retail store in Santa Barbara California.

Kelly has won the event a total of 3 times in 2000, 2003, and 2005.
